最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
智能化编程工具如何革新计算机网络开发
在当今数字化时代,计算机网络作为信息技术的基石,其重要性不言而喻。无论是企业级应用还是个人项目,计算机网络的开发和维护都面临着复杂性和多样性的挑战。为了应对这些挑战,开发者们需要更加高效、智能的工具来简化工作流程,提高生产力。近年来,随着人工智能技术的迅猛发展,智能化编程工具逐渐成为开发者的新宠。本文将探讨智能化编程工具如何革新计算机网络开发,并介绍一款革命性的AI编程助手——它不仅能够大幅提升开发效率,还能帮助编程新手快速上手。
1. 计算机网络开发的现状与挑战
计算机网络开发涉及到多个层次的技术栈,从底层的协议设计到高层的应用开发,每个环节都需要精确的代码实现和严格的测试。传统的开发模式往往依赖于开发者的经验和手动编写代码,这不仅耗时费力,还容易引入错误。尤其是在面对复杂的网络架构和多变的需求时,传统方法显得尤为吃力。
此外,随着云计算、物联网(IoT)和5G等新兴技术的普及,计算机网络开发的复杂度进一步增加。开发者需要处理更多的数据传输、安全问题以及跨平台兼容性。在这种背景下,如何提高开发效率、降低开发门槛,成为亟待解决的问题。
2. 智能化编程工具的崛起
智能化编程工具通过集成人工智能和机器学习算法,为开发者提供了一种全新的编程体验。这类工具的核心优势在于它们能够理解开发者的意图,自动完成代码生成、调试、优化等一系列任务,从而极大地简化了开发过程。
以某款新型AI编程助手为例,这款工具内置了强大的自然语言处理(NLP)引擎,允许开发者通过简单的对话输入需求,系统即可自动生成符合要求的代码。这种“对话式编程”的方式,使得即便是没有编程经验的新手,也能够轻松完成复杂的网络开发任务。同时,该工具还具备智能代码补全、错误检测、性能优化等功能,确保生成的代码既高效又可靠。
3. 应用场景:简化计算机网络开发
3.1 快速搭建网络应用
在网络应用开发中,开发者常常需要处理大量的配置文件和复杂的逻辑代码。例如,在构建一个基于HTTP协议的Web服务器时,开发者需要编写路由处理、请求解析、响应生成等模块。使用智能化编程工具,开发者只需输入自然语言描述,如“创建一个HTTP服务器,监听8080端口,处理GET和POST请求”,工具便会自动生成相应的代码框架。这不仅节省了大量的时间,还减少了出错的可能性。
3.2 自动化网络配置管理
对于企业级网络环境,网络配置管理是一项繁琐且容易出错的任务。智能化编程工具可以通过分析现有的网络拓扑结构,自动生成配置脚本,确保各个节点之间的通信畅通无阻。此外,工具还可以实时监控网络状态,自动调整配置参数,以应对突发的流量高峰或安全威胁。这种自动化管理方式,大大提高了网络的稳定性和安全性。
3.3 提升代码质量和性能
在计算机网络开发中,代码质量和性能至关重要。智能化编程工具不仅能自动生成高质量的代码,还能对现有代码进行深度分析,找出潜在的性能瓶颈并提出优化建议。例如,在处理大量并发连接时,工具可以建议使用更高效的算法或数据结构,从而提升系统的整体性能。此外,工具还可以生成单元测试用例,确保代码的正确性和稳定性。
4. 巨大价值:助力开发者成长
智能化编程工具不仅提升了开发效率,还在以下几个方面为开发者带来了巨大价值:
4.1 降低入门门槛
对于初学者来说,编程往往是令人望而却步的难题。智能化编程工具通过简化代码生成和调试过程,降低了编程的难度,使更多的人能够参与到计算机网络开发中来。无论你是学生、业余爱好者还是转行者,都可以借助工具快速上手,逐步掌握编程技能。
4.2 提高创新能力
当开发者不再被繁琐的代码编写所束缚,他们可以将更多的时间和精力投入到创意和设计中。智能化编程工具可以帮助开发者快速实现想法,验证假设,从而激发更多的创新灵感。这对于推动计算机网络技术的发展具有重要意义。
4.3 加速项目交付
在商业环境中,项目的交付时间和质量是决定成败的关键因素。智能化编程工具通过自动化生成代码、优化性能、生成测试用例等功能,显著缩短了开发周期,提高了项目的交付速度。这对于企业来说,意味着更快的产品上市时间和更高的市场竞争力。
5. 引导读者下载:开启智能编程新时代
如果你是一名计算机网络开发者,或者对编程感兴趣但苦于缺乏经验,不妨尝试一下这款智能化编程工具。它不仅能够大幅提高你的工作效率,还能帮助你快速掌握编程技巧,成为一名优秀的开发者。现在就下载这款工具,开启智能编程的新时代吧!
通过上述内容可以看出,智能化编程工具在计算机网络开发中的应用前景广阔。它不仅简化了开发流程,提高了代码质量和性能,还为开发者提供了更多的创新空间和发展机会。未来,随着技术的不断进步,智能化编程工具必将在计算机网络领域发挥更大的作用,引领新一轮的技术革命。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考